  • @JpRocca813 Macroevolution happens over large periods of time, through microevolution. Genetic variation due to processes such as mutation, selection or genetic drift changes allele frequencies in a population. This eventually modifies one species to the point that they become another species, the process of speciation. This has been observed, and the evidence, shown by transitional fossils, has also been observed.
